Sourdough being a Nutritional Powerhouse
Sourdough bread, in contrast, is commonly celebrated for its nutritional Gains. Manufactured through a all-natural fermentation process, sourdough features a lower glycemic index when compared with other breads, this means it's a slower influence on blood sugar degrees. This causes it to be a better selection for retaining Power degrees through the entire college working day.

In addition, the fermentation system in sourdough breaks down a few of the gluten and phytic acid from the flour, rendering it much easier to digest and maximizing the bioavailability of nutrients like magnesium, iron, and zinc. This positions sourdough as a nutritious option for college meals, specially when built with entire grains.

The Accessibility of Sourdough: Cost and Preparation Issues
Even though sourdough features several well being Gains, its integration into faculty food stuff programs isn't devoid of worries. One significant barrier is cost. Sourdough bread, significantly when manufactured with significant-good quality, natural components, could be more expensive than commercially created bread. This makes it complicated for colleges, especially Those people with confined budgets, to offer sourdough regularly.

An additional obstacle is preparation. Sourdough requires a longer fermentation system, which can be tricky to take care of in a college kitchen. Some colleges have resolved this by partnering with regional bakeries, but this Alternative might not be possible in all places.
